Features

  • Available with Hach LDO
  • Memory is included on every sonde
  • Improved power management
  • Four built-in expansion ports configured to fit your specific needs
  • Measures up to 10 parameters simultaneously
  • Compact and lightweight 1.75" diameter housing fits into groundwater wells
  • Used for attended or unattended monitoring
  • All Series 5 Sondes are rated to a depth of 225 meters, with Depth sensor electronics integrated onto the main board, freeing a daughter card slot
  • 512 KB memory is included with every Series 5 Sonde capable of storing up to 180,000 readings
  • RS 232, RS 485, and SDI-12 communication protocols are all included
  • Improved power management resulting in longer battery life and more robust protection against over-voltage conditions
  • New operator's manual
  • Sealed battery compartment
  • Hach LDO...available only on Hydrolab Series 5 instruments
  • All Series 5 instruments include a weighted sensor guard, storage and calibration cup, maintenance kits and manual and are backed by a two-year warranty

General Description

For more specific water quality measurements (Temperature, DO, Conductivity, and pH plus up to two additional sensors), the Hydrolab MS5 offers an optimized selection Hydrolab's superior sensors on a compact and lightweight multiprobe designed for either profiling or unattended monitoring.

Specifications

Size: Outer diameter - 1.75 in/4.4 cm
Length - 21 in/53.3 cm
Length (with battery pack) - 29.5 in/74.9 cm
Weight: 2.2 lbs/1.0 kg
(with battery pack) - 2.9 lbs/1.3 kg
Computer Interface: RS-232, SDI-12, RS-485
Memory: 120,000 measurements
Battery Supply: 8 AA batteries
Operating Temperature: -5 to 50° C
Maximum Depth: 225 m

Sensors

Parameter Range Accuracy Resolution
Hach LDOTM 0 to 60 mg/L ±0.1 mg/L @ < 8mg/L
±0.2 mg/L @ > 8mg/L
0.01mg/L
Polarographic DO 0 to 50 mg/L ±0.2 mg/L @ < 20mg/L
±0.6 mg/L @ > 20mg/L
0.01mg/L
Conductivity 0 to 100 mS/cm ±0.5% of reading;
±0.001 mS/cm
4 digits
pH 0 to 14 units ±0.2 units 0.01 units
Turbidity, Self-Cleaning 0 to 3000 NTU Compared to StablCal
1% up to 100 NTU
3% from 100-400 NTU
5% from 400-3000 NTU
0.1 NTU from 0-400 NTU
1 NTU for >400 NTU
Turbidity, 4-Beam 0 to 1000 NTU 5% of reading; or ± 1 NTU 0.1 NTU from 0-100 NTU
1 NTU >100 NTU
Depth 0 to 10m (Vented Level) ±0.003m 0.001m
0 to 25m ±0.05m 0.01m
0 to 100m ±0.05m 0.01m
0 to 200m ±0.1m 0.1m
Chlorophyll a Dynamic Range
Low sensitivity: 0.03 to 500 µg/L
Med. sensitivity: 0.03 to 50 µg/L
High sensitivity: 0.03 to 5 µg/L
±3% for signal levels equivalens of 1 ppb rhodamine WT dye or higher using a rhodamine sensor 0.01µg/L
Blue-Green Algae Dynamic Range
Low sensitivity: 100 to 2,000,000 cells/mL
Med. sensitivity: 100 to 200,000 cells/L
High sensitivity: 100 to 20,000 cellsL
±3% for signal levels equivalens of 1 ppb rhodamine WT dye or higher using a rhodamine sensor 20 cells/L
Ion Selective Electrodes
Ammonia
Max Depth: 15 meters
0 to 100 mg/L-N Greater of ±5% of reading or ±2 mg/L-N 0.01 mg/L-N
Nitrate
Max Depth: 15 meters
0 to 100 mg/L-N Greater of ±5% of reading or ±2 mg/L-N 0.01 mg/L-N
Chloride
Max Depth: 15 meters
0.5 to 18,000 mg/L greater of ±5% of reading or ±2 mg/L 4 digits
TGO (Total Dissolved Gas) 400 to 1300 mmHg ±0.1% of span 1.0 mmHg
ORP -999 to 999 mV ±20mV 1mV
Rhodamine WT Dynamic Range
Low sensitivity: 0.04 - 1000 ppb
Med. sensitivity: 0.04 - 100 ppb
High sensitivity: 0.04 - 10 ppb
±3% for signal levels equivalens of 1 ppb rhodamine WT dye or higher using a rhodamine sensor 0.01 ppb
PAR 0 to 10,000 µmols-1m-2 ±5% of reading or ±1µmol s-1m-2 1µmol s-1m-2
Temperature -5°  to 50°C ±0.10°C 0.01°C
